Output 2982e1bf6d75a53073144adfda32b31b4d66f5c4a9e36957ae24658d5fe65cfa:39

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57123a875171e25e21a07d271e2266ef49cc4e52db5ffe777dad26e60776e24a
address
bc1p2ufr4p63w839ugdq05n3ugnxaayucnjjmd0luama45nwvpmkuf9qs42v28
transaction
2982e1bf6d75a53073144adfda32b31b4d66f5c4a9e36957ae24658d5fe65cfa
spent
true